Health Violations by Year

2022 8 violations

Tag 0565 E Aug 24, 2022

Honor the resident's right to organize and participate in resident/family groups in the facility.

βœ“ Corrected: Nov 14, 2022
Tag 0572 E Aug 24, 2022

Give residents a notice of rights, rules, services and charges.

βœ“ Corrected: Nov 14, 2022
Tag 0656 D Aug 24, 2022

Develop and implement a complete care plan that meets all the resident's needs, with timetables and actions that can be measured.

βœ“ Corrected: Oct 20, 2022
Tag 0679 E Aug 24, 2022

Provide activities to meet all resident's needs.

βœ“ Corrected: Nov 14, 2022
Tag 0684 D Aug 24, 2022

Provide appropriate treatment and care according to orders, resident’s preferences and goals.

βœ“ Corrected: Oct 20, 2022
Tag 0698 D Aug 24, 2022

Provide safe, appropriate dialysis care/services for a resident who requires such services.

βœ“ Corrected: Nov 14, 2022
Tag 0812 D Aug 24, 2022

Procure food from sources approved or considered satisfactory and store, prepare, distribute and serve food in accordance with professional standards.

βœ“ Corrected: Nov 2, 2022
Tag 0943 D Aug 24, 2022

Give their staff education on dementia care, and what abuse, neglect, and exploitation are; and how to report abuse, neglect, and exploitation.

βœ“ Corrected: Oct 20, 2022

2021 1 violations

Tag 0584 E May 26, 2021

Honor the resident's right to a safe, clean, comfortable and homelike environment, including but not limited to receiving treatment and supports for daily living safely.

βœ“ Corrected: Jun 18, 2021

2019 6 violations

Tag 0550 D Jun 6, 2019

Honor the resident's right to a dignified existence, self-determination, communication, and to exercise his or her rights.

βœ“ Corrected: Jul 24, 2019
Tag 0582 B Jun 6, 2019

Give residents notice of Medicaid/Medicare coverage and potential liability for services not covered.

βœ“ Corrected: Jul 24, 2019
Tag 0689 D Jun 6, 2019

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ents.

βœ“ Corrected: Jul 24, 2019
Tag 0757 D Jun 6, 2019

Ensure each resident’s drug regimen must be free from unnecessary drugs.

βœ“ Corrected: Jul 24, 2019
Tag 0758 D Jun 6, 2019

Implement gradual dose reductions(GDR) and non-pharmacological interventions, unless contraindicated, prior to initiating or instead of continuing psychotropic medication; and PRN orders for psychotropic medications are only used when the medication is necessary and PRN use is limited.

βœ“ Corrected: Jul 24, 2019
Tag 0791 D Jun 6, 2019

Provide or obtain dental services for each resident.

βœ“ Corrected: Jul 24, 2019

2018 2 violations

Tag 0761 E Jun 14, 2018

Ensure drugs and biologicals used in the facility are labeled in accordance with currently accepted professional principles; and all drugs and biologicals must be stored in locked compartments, separately locked, compartments for controlled drugs.

βœ“ Corrected: Aug 14, 2018
Tag 0883 D Jun 14, 2018

Develop and implement policies and procedures for flu and pneumonia vaccinations.

βœ“ Corrected: Aug 14, 2018

2017 2 violations

Tag 0156 D Apr 27, 2017

Give residents a notice of rights, rules, services and charges.

βœ“ Corrected: Jun 1, 2017
Tag 0372 E Apr 27, 2017

Dispose of garbage and refuse properly.

βœ“ Corrected: Jun 1, 2017
πŸ₯ Facility Summary

SANFIELD REHAB & LIVING CENTER is a 5-star nursing home in HARTLAND, ME with 23 beds.

Most recent inspection: Data not available. No current violations on record.
